To summarize a few points in this thread, some already addressed above, others a little open ended.

I agree that there will be 2022 "Bronco" orders that get pushed to 2023, my wife's 2022 Badlands order will likely be amongst them and this is exactly what we anticipated based on commodities. The latest communication I've found from Ford Performance is that all 2022 Bronco Raptor orders will be built as 2022 model year. I haven't found any official communication from Ford when Bronco Raptor's will be offered again, however it has been commented by Ford Performance there will be future Bronco Raptors but not yet determined when and what model year.

The 2nd and 3rd week of July unscheduled Bronco Raptors were being scheduled. This the Biggest Positive news since April when the initial few were scheduled for May builds. Ford would not have started scheduling again if there wasn't an adequate confidence level that the current scheduled Bronco Raptors were going to be completed and shipping soon.

New car dealerships around the globe are frustrated with supplies, availability, and lack of communication from manufactures. I can imagine dealers being pressured by customers demanding answers that are Not available and may provide answers to temporarily appease their customers, this is simply my assumption based on new automotive news in general.

Colors, not all Bronco colors were available for Bronco Raptors, notably Carbonized Gray metallic and Race Red. Code Orange is only a "Ford Performance" color option, thus further emphasizing the Raptor as "special". I would expect more special edition models that have a color or colors only available on that edition. It's not safe to assume new colors offered with Bronco or other Bronco special editions will ever be offered on a future Bronco Raptor, whenever Ford decides to offer the Bronco Raptor again.

Who confirmed this for you?
Ford Performance. During the Bronco Raptor reveal on January 24, 2022, it was stated that production will begin in the spring of 2022 and customer deliveries will begin in the summer of 2022. It's now summer and we are expecting customer Bronco Raptors to start being delivered within the next couple of weeks. It was also stated by Ford Performance that its a 2022 Mid Model Year special edition run and there isn't any confirmed plans of when the BR will be produced again.

Bronco Raptor production is still on track, maybe a couple weeks of delay, no big deal and no different than those that ordered a highly sought after F-150 Raptor since introduction in 2010.
